Sandy Koufax World Series Wraps Up

Share on RSS

 

The 2015 Sandy Koufax World Series wrapped up with the title game on Sunday afternoon. 

The Dallas Tigers took home the championship, beating the Nashville Knights 13-4. Dallas finished the tournament at 5-0. 

The win for the Tigers wrapped up the 18-game event over five days at Bill Doenges Memorial Stadium. Dallas coach Todd Troxler says he was impressed with the event and the city of Bartlesville.

The Tigers played 75 games together this summer, with the season culminating in Bartlesville. Troxler says the event couldn't have put a better cap on the season. He also adds that it leaves the players with a great impression of baseball as a sport.   

Tournament organized Debbie Mueggenborg echoed the thoughts of Troxler. She says the tournament went off without a hitch, and even got a little help from Mother Nature toward the end. 

In addition to the venue and the quality of the event, Troxler said he was impressed by the little details that his players got to enjoy. Little league baseball doesn't usually have regular field maintenance or public address announcers. 

Overall the participants and organizers of the event were pleased with the product. Mueggenborg says she can envision Bartlesville keeping this event for a while.
